Output 3285877b7df1f1adb07e4aabd64295d8a33520d8f1809428a2ffc8ffa2eabe88:3

value
702950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b2cd0bbbd908cdcbd1fd5e4d6cd61cb9845c419 OP_EQUAL
address
375uUgrGc5yG4TJFyN3hybiM3JcGgz8TTe
transaction
3285877b7df1f1adb07e4aabd64295d8a33520d8f1809428a2ffc8ffa2eabe88
confirmations
103634
spent
true